Manages risk

Artificial intelligence (AI) can be used to help financial institutions manage risk. The technology can handle vast amounts of data, including both structured and unstructured data, and can use algorithms to analyze past cases and identify early indicators of future problems. These tools can also analyze real-time activities to provide accurate predictions and detailed forecasts.

AI has many potential risks, including those related to data and the use of models, cybersecurity, and the privacy and confidentiality of customer data. Managing these risks requires identifying and categorizing the types of risks that can occur and establishing clear guidelines and procedures. The risk management process should also include appropriate governance and risk management practices.

Artificial intelligence is increasingly becoming a central part of the banking industry, especially in risk management functions. Following the global financial crisis, banks have become more focused on risk detection and reporting. Using AI for risk management functions can result in faster and more accurate decision-making. Moreover, AI solutions can improve the accuracy of credit scores, model validation, and stress testing.

The AI models used to evaluate and monitor transactions will continue to become increasingly complex. They will be able to solve complex stochastic differential equations, allowing them to be used in complex situations. These systems can even help in fraud detection, anti-money laundering, and transaction monitoring.

Automates tax filing process

Automating tax filing can be a big project. It requires determining which processes are high-volume and have high return on investment (ROI). These processes can include creating reports, gathering data, calculating adjustments, and populating tax forms. A checklist can help you identify which tasks are suitable for automation.

Automated tax filing allows you to save time by reducing the number of manual steps. RPA can help you automate structured tax processes and generate efficiencies within the tax function. TaxAct Software is a cloud-based accounting software solution for tax professionals. It automates the tax filing process by providing a centralized, open hub of accounting data and a robust reporting architecture.

Robotic automation is an important innovation in tax preparation. The process of filing taxes can be automated using robots, which are software programs that perform repetitive tasks. Using robots can help organizations reduce their human resources and improve efficiency. In addition, they can operate around the clock and provide high-quality service.

Automation is not without challenges. It can be difficult to overcome the technical challenges of this new technology. For example, IT departments may not support the new technology. A key concern is proving a return on investment. If the ROI for tax automation is not immediate, many firms will remain satisfied with the manual process.

Reduces customer service costs

AI-powered chatbots can help organizations reduce customer service costs by handling routine questions. These AI-powered bots can handle a wide variety of questions, including routine questions that are derived from internal systems. This helps businesses handle more customer inquiries, increase the number of people who can be helped, and reduce operational costs.

Another way AI saves companies money is by making better decisions. For instance, JPMorgan Chase, which generates more than 50% of its net income from consumer banking, has developed a proprietary AI algorithm to spot fraud patterns. The system analyzes credit card transactions to determine whether they are fraudulent. This technology is saving the company $25 million in customer service costs a year.

AI can also detect fraudulent activities and improve compliance. Chatbots, digital payment advisers, and biometric fraud detection mechanisms can improve the overall customer experience while reducing operating costs. Juniper Research estimates that the use of chatbots in banking will save up to $7.3 billion by 2023.

Finance AI-powered chatbots are also capable of monitoring customer requests and problems without the need for additional staff. Previously, banks may have needed to employ more human agents to handle customer queries, which meant more spending on customer service and labor. Furthermore, poor customer service can lead to customers leaving a bank and searching for another one.
